Frequently Asked Questions

How do I choose the right LMS?

Start with your use case (internal training vs. selling courses vs. academic), then your scale and budget, then your non-negotiable features. The features that most narrow your shortlist are the rare ones — native live sessions (15% of platforms), multi-tenant (21%), and built-in billing (35%). Our LMS Selector quiz walks you through this in 2 minutes.

What should I prioritize when selecting an LMS?

Prioritize the features that are both essential to you AND rare in the market, since those narrow your options fastest. Also weigh pricing model (flat-rate beats per-user past ~500 learners) and whether you'll sell courses (transaction fees compound over time). The quiz tailors priorities to your answers.
